Transaction 7370577fac6f917c9d582e871ea82394af0a8a519c754be08c4b46e4696fea45

13 Input
1 Outputs
  • 7370577fac6f917c9d582e871ea82394af0a8a519c754be08c4b46e4696fea45:0
  • value  236667
    address  tb1q4f6xj4qwtjq0d6l25kgstu03tyqnfswmqhpgpk